ODESSA - Three goals wasn't enough for the Wylie girls soccer team on the road Tuesday night at Odessa High.

The Lady Bulldogs finished on the wrong side of a 7-3 score line at Ratliff Stadium.

Wylie's goals came from Addison Adkins off a Skylar Stump assist, Allie Allen unassisted and Maci Hanson on a penalty kick. Avery Anders made five saves as the Lady Bulldogs fall to 2-4-1.

"I was proud of our effort in this game," Wylie coach Madison Martin said. "We are going to learn as much from this game as possible and look forward towards the next task."

Friday's game against Snyder was canceled by the Lady Tigers, so the next game for Wylie comes at home Tuesday against Midland Greenwood.
